import React, {useEffect, useState} from "react"; import { HomeIcon, EnvelopeIcon, UserIcon, BuildingStorefrontIcon, BriefcaseIcon, } from "@heroicons/react/24/outline" const GridLayout = ({ children }) => { const [selectedPage, setSelectedPage] = useState(() => { const storedPage = localStorage.getItem('selectedPage'); return storedPage ? storedPage : 'home'; }); useEffect(() => { localStorage.setItem('selectedPage', selectedPage); }, [selectedPage]); const handlePageClick = (page) => { setSelectedPage(page); }; return (
{/*Left column - sticky */}
{/*Middle column */}
{children}
{/*Right column */}
); } export default GridLayout;